
随机游走序列,随机序列生成器
- 科技
- 2023-09-28
- 7

随机数发生器有哪些 真随机数生成器(True Random Number Generators,TRNGs):这种方法使用物理过程中的随机事件来生成真正的随机数。例如,...
随机数发生器有哪些
真随机数生成器(True Random Number Generators,TRNGs):这种方法使用物理过程中的随机事件来生成真正的随机数。例如,通过测量大气噪声、放射性衰变或者其他无法预测的物理现象来获取随机性。
量子随机数发生器是基于量子物理原理或量子效应而产生真随机数的系统, 在实用化量子密码系统等领域中具有重要的应用。比特率是量子随机数发生器最重要的指标。
C语言中有三个通用的随机数发生器,分别为 rand函数, random函数, randomize 函数。
有可以去除指定数字的随机数生成器,JavaScript实现随机数生成器。随机数生成器app特色:每次生成的数都是随机性的,每次生成的随机数之间互不干扰,没有关联。
这样的发生器叫做伪随机数发生器。在真正关键性的应用中,比如在密码学中,人们一般使用真正的随机数。C语言、C++、C#、Java、Matlab等程序语言和软件中都有对应的随机数生成函数,如rand等。
伪随机序列生成器的初始化有什么意义
“srand(time(NULL));”这条指令的意思是利用系统时间来初始化系统随机数的种子值,使得每次运行由于时间不同产生而产生不同的随机数序列。srand函数是随机数发生器的初始化函数。
说明:Randomize 用 number 将 Rnd 函数的随机数生成器初始化,该随机数生成器给 number 一个新的种子 值。如果省略 number,则用系统计时器返回的值作为新的种子值。
梅森(Mersenne)是一种伪随机数生成器,它是由数学家梅森(Mersenne)在17世纪提出的。它的特点是生成速度快,且随机性好。在计算机科学中,梅森算法是一种常用的随机数生成算法。
srand函数相当于初始化随机数函数,传递一个数值作为随机数种子(通常使用当前时间)然后调用rand函数产生随机数。
技术难度的限制最后,技术上的限制也是导致游戏中只能使用伪随机的原因之一。在游戏中,需要生成大量的随机数,这需要消耗大量的计算资源和时间。
什么小程序可以随机生成150组六位数
1、排序小助手。排序小助手是免费的抽签排序小程序,集随机排序、手速排序、定量分组等功能于一身,适用于活动、办公等场景。不能指定抽到中间位置,随机排序。
2、微信抽数字的小程序开发制作功能有:随机数生成器,可以自定义随机数生成区间和生成个数,页面简洁,方便使用。
3、点击enter键即生成了一个随机数。 选中该单元格,向下拖拽左下角,即生成十二个符合条件的数值。 使用筛选功能中的排序功能,将数字按顺序排列,这样名字也随机排序。 再根据几人一组按顺序分配即可。
4、Php中生成6位随机数并显示实现如下:使用shuffle函数生成随机数。
5、大家在制作网页或者小程序的时候经常用到随机数,作者整理了一个很简单的JS生成随机数的程序,一起学习下。
随机数生成器
“srand(time(NULL));”这条指令的意思是利用系统时间来初始化系统随机数的种子值,使得每次运行由于时间不同产生而产生不同的随机数序列。srand函数是随机数发生器的初始化函数。
随机数发生器有以下:伪随机数生成器:这是一种基于确定性算法的随机数生成器,通过特定的算法和种子值生成看似随机的数字序列。这种随机数生成器的随机性是有限的,因为其产生的数字序列是可预测的。
梅森(Mersenne)是一种伪随机数生成器,它是由数学家梅森(Mersenne)在17世纪提出的。它的特点是生成速度快,且随机性好。在计算机科学中,梅森算法是一种常用的随机数生成算法。
一个可以随机生成150组六位数的小程序是随机数生成器。随机数生成器是一种能够生成随机数的工具或算法。它可以根据设定的范围和数量生成符合要求的随机数。
excel生成1到100的随机数
首先,打开Excel表格程序,进入到Excel表格程序的操作主界面中。然后,Excel表格中,选中一格空白单元格,在单元格中输入“=rand()*100”,回车确定。
在电脑上打开EXCEL文件,选择一个空白的单元格,在单元格中输入=RANDBETWEEN。可以看到当前显示的为未识别结果,在该公式的后面输入(1,100)即表明产生的数据在1和100之间随机出现。
详细步骤:打开wps office。在A1单元格输入=rand()。输入完成,下拉单元格,生成随机数。在B1单元格输入=rank(a1,a:a),单元格下拉(按照需要的量)。生成随机不重复的整数。
=INT(100*RAND()+1)excel中在F1-F10取1-10之间不重复的随机整数,如何实现?使用什么函式?举例,A1输入 =RAND() B1输入=RANK(A1,$A$1:$A$10),下拉A1:B1到第10行。这样B1:B10就是10个不重复的整数。
Excel中可以用randbetween()函数来生成随机数字,这里以生成1到100中间的随机数为例。
由何人用什么方法产生随机数列
在一个新的列输入公式:=INT(RAND()*100);此公式是返回范围100以内平均分布的随机数的意思。下列复制这个公式,使其产生更多的随机数。然后重新复制粘贴这段随机数只保留值,不保留格式。
产生随机数有多种不同的方法。这些方法被称为随机数发生器。随机数最重要的特性是它在产生是后面的那个数与前面的那个数毫无关系。
随机数由一个原始的数据(称为随机数种子)按照一定的程序产生的。由于随机数依赖于随机数种子,取不同的种子,会产生一列不同的随机数。
在线随机数生成器,可以随机生成你设定的随机数,可以是唯一的或者重复的,根据你指定的最小数和最大数生成相应的随机数, 在你需要抽签、随机选择的时候非常的便利。另外,你还可以把它当成别样的色子来用。
Excel 中生成随机数的常用方法:使用 RANDBETWEEN 函数生成随机数 在 Excel 中打开一个空白表格,选中要填充随机数的单元格。在菜单栏中找到“公式”选项,点击“数学和三角函数”图标,选择“RANDBETWEEN”函数。
本文链接:http://www.depponpd.com/ke/35742.html